  1. 7th Gen Celica Super Strut question

    Hello everyone, I have a question regarding the Super Strut suspension that was offered as a factory modification on the 7th gen Celica. As far as I know this kind of modification was only available on the SSII Celica in Japan, no? From diagrams on the internet I found out the this type...